Baked Sweet Potatoes with Feta

Detailed Ingredients with measures

– 4 medium sweet potatoes
– 200 grams of feta cheese
– A handful of fresh parsley
– 3 tablespoons of olive oil
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Optional: a squeeze of lemon juice for added freshness

Detailed Directions and Instructions

Step 1: Prepare the Sweet Potatoes

Preheat your oven to 200°C (392°F). Wash and scrub the sweet potatoes thoroughly under running water. Pat them dry with a towel.

Step 2: Cutting the Sweet Potatoes

Cut the sweet potatoes into wedges or cubes, ensuring even sizes for uniform cooking.

Step 3: Season the Sweet Potatoes

In a large mixing bowl, toss the sweet potato pieces with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Make sure they are evenly coated.

Step 4: Arrange on a Baking Sheet

Spread the seasoned sweet potato pieces in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per to prevent sticking.

Step 5: Bake the Sweet Potatoes

Place the baking sheet in the pre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es, flipping halfway through, until they are tender and slightly caramelized.

Step 6: Prepare the Topping

While the sweet potatoes are baking, chop fresh parsley and crumble feta cheese.

Step 7: Combine and Serve

Once the sweet potatoes are done, remove them from the oven and transfer them to a serving dish. Sprinkle the chopped parsley and crumbled feta cheese over the top before serving.

Notes

Note 1: Sweet Potato Types

You can use different types of sweet potatoes, such as orange-fleshed or purple-fleshed, depending on availability and preference.

Note 2: Additional Seasoning

Feel free to add additional spices or herbs like garlic powder, paprika, or rosemary to enhance the flavor.

Note 3: Serving Suggestions

These roasted sweet potatoes pair well with grilled meats, salads, or as a stand-alone dish.

Note 4: Storage

Leftover sweet potatoes can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. Reheat in the oven or microwave before serving.

FAQ

Can I use other types of cheese instead of feta?

Yes, you can substitute feta with goat cheese, ricotta, or any cheese of your preference that complements the dish.

What herbs can I use besides parsley?

You can experiment with other herbs like cilantro, thyme, or rosemary for different flavor profiles.

How do I know when the sweet potatoes are done?

Sweet potatoes are done when they are fork-tender and have a golden-brown color on the outside.

Can I prepare this dish ahead of time?

Yes, you can chop and season the sweet potatoes in advance, then store them in the refrigerator until you’re ready to roast them.

Is it possible to add protein to this dish?

Certainly! Grilled chicken or chickpeas would pair well with sweet potatoes and add a protein boost to the meal.
